How do I choose a B760‑based motherboard for a gaming build?
Start by confirming compatibility with Intel processors in the 12th to 14th generations and the LGA 1700 socket. Two key decisions are memory type (DDR4 vs DDR5) and expansion needs. PCIe 4.0 support enables fast storage and GPUs, while multiple M.2 slots boost drive options. Look for robust cooling with VRM and PCH heatsinks, plus modern networking such as Realtek 2.5Gb Ethernet, and optional Wi‑Fi. Finally, choose a micro ATX board if you want a compact, feature‑rich foundation for a gaming PC.
What is the difference between DDR4 and DDR5 variants in this line?
DDR4 boards generally offer solid performance at a lower price point, with mature compatibility across many CPUs. DDR5 variants provide higher potential bandwidth and future‑proofing for memory‑intensive tasks, though they can come with a premium. In this lineup, you’ll see both DDR4 and DDR5 options, so pick DDR5 if you plan a long‑term upgrade path and DDR4 if you’re working within a tighter budget while still chasing strong gaming performance.

What form factor and expansion options should I expect?
Most boards in this set come in micro ATX form factor, which fits compact mid‑tower cases while still offering multiple expansion options. Expect at least two PCIe 4.0 M.2 slots for fast NVMe storage, several USB ports including front‑panel headers, and multiple PCIe slots. Memory support typically includes dual‑channel configurations, with support for substantial RAM capacity depending on DDR4 or DDR5 choice, enabling solid multitasking and gaming performance.
